Output 5a89fa39325b509101baf8a4673903bb69275db50b6d15d072a78f0a7b84b5e7:21

value
1367496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 040fe64cc83673a546943d9d5b7f6aec52fef625 OP_EQUAL
address
324Vg2zwnpFqb4MsRvuHhPwSKvhhYdVn3C
transaction
5a89fa39325b509101baf8a4673903bb69275db50b6d15d072a78f0a7b84b5e7
spent
true